
SPECIALTY WELDMENTS: WHAT THEY ARE AND WHEN YOU NEED CUSTOM FABRICATION
A specialty weldment is a fabricated assembly built for a specific, non-standard application, a bracket, frame, mount, or structural component that doesn't exist as a catalog part because the application doesn't fit a catalog part. If you can order it from a supplier's parts list, it's not a specialty weldment. If it has to be designed and built to fit a specific piece of equipment, a specific space, or a specific load condition, it is.
Most projects have at least a few of these: a mounting frame for a piece of equipment that was never designed with mounting in mind, a bracket that has to clear an obstruction no standard part accounts for, a structural component that ties two different systems together. Every weldment is a fabricated assembly of steel parts joined by welding. What makes one a specialty weldment is that it's a one-off, or a small run, designed for a specific application rather than pulled from a standard product line. That could mean a custom equipment mount that has to match bolt patterns on both a piece of machinery and an existing foundation, a structural bracket that has to carry an odd load path around an obstruction, or an assembly that combines materials or geometries a standard part doesn't cover.
The defining trait isn't complexity, some specialty weldments are simple, it's that the part has to be engineered for the specific application rather than selected from a catalog.
- Nothing in a supplier catalog fits — If you've checked standard product lines and nothing matches the bolt pattern, clearance, or load requirement, that's the clearest signal. Forcing a standard part to work with shims, field modification, or workarounds usually costs more in labor and risk than fabricating the right part.
- Two systems have to tie together and neither was designed for the other — Retrofits and equipment upgrades often need a transition piece, mount, or bracket that connects new equipment to an existing structure that was never designed to receive it.
- The load path is non-standard — Odd angles, offset loads, or equipment that has to be supported from an unusual point all push a project out of catalog-part territory and into custom design.
- Space or access constraints rule out standard geometry — Confined spaces, tight equipment rooms, and retrofit conditions frequently require a part shaped to fit the space rather than the other way around.
Specialty weldment work starts with the same question every custom fabrication project starts with: what does this part actually need to do, and what does it need to fit? JMC can work from customer-supplied drawings, or build the design from scratch using CAD/CAM drafting and Revit BIM modeling when the part needs to be engineered from a field condition or an equipment spec sheet rather than an existing drawing.
Material selection depends on the application, carbon steel for most structural brackets and mounts, stainless steel where the environment is corrosive or the application is sanitary, and other materials as the job requires. Welding on specialty weldments is performed by AWS certified welders, with NAVSEA certification available for marine work, and dimensional and fit-up verification happens before the part ships, since a specialty part that doesn't fit its one specific application has no other use.
Because these are one-off or low-volume parts, the RFI and fabricability review step matters more than it does on standard products. Catching a clearance problem or a load path issue on the drawing is far cheaper than catching it after the part is built.
For an accurate quote on a custom weldment, provide:
- A drawing or sketch of the part, or the equipment spec sheet and field dimensions if no drawing exists yet
- What the part connects to on both ends, bolt patterns, mounting points, or interface dimensions
- Load requirements, if known, static weight, dynamic loads, or vibration considerations
- Material preference or application environment, so the fabricator can recommend material if you haven't specified one
- Quantity, one-off or a small production run
- Finish requirements, paint, galvanizing, or bare metal
